Environment Protection Officer (SEPA)
This position will take responsibilities to provide regulation & enforcement of a range of environmental legislation including protection of the water environment (controls on point source discharges, engineering, abstractions and impoundments), emissions to air from prescribed processes, the storage, treatment, transfer & disposal of controlled waste (excluding radioactive waste) and the use of sealed radioactive sources (Application Deadline: 8 February 2012).
Key Responsibilities
- To scrutinise and assess applications for (or proposed changes to) a range of environmental permits.
- To prepare licences/authorisations/permits/consents (or amendments to those already existing) including relevant conditions, for consideration by the SEPO/Team Leader and Area Licensing Team.
- To inspect sites, premises, processes, watercourses etc. and assess the level of compliance with statutory requirements and authorisation conditions to ensure improvements in operator performance and in the quality of the environment.
- To initiate enforcement action where necessary, within the delegated authority of the post and in line with SEPA policy.
- To investigate complaints and reports of pollution, taking appropriate actions, preparing relevant reports and dealing with the public.
